Paul Delaney (born 18 October 1968) is a former professional rugby league footballer who played as a scrum-half in the 1980s and 1990s for Leeds and Dewsbury.[3]

Delaney’s son Brad Delaney, and nephew Jim Delaney both play for the Dewsbury in the Kingstone Press Championship.[4][5][6]
